That's weird. Because I can request https://api.epicgames.dev/sdk/v1/default?platformId=WIN with my browser and if I look at the certificate, *.epicgames.dev is clearly among the Subject Alt Names. I'll do some more digging because I probably suffer from the same problem :angry:

/Edit: oh well, look at this, I managed to reproduce the bug by specifically using the same server IP address you were using 3d ago:
benjamin@workstation:~$ curl -vvI --resolve api.epicgames.dev:443:44.198.255.91 https://api.epicgames.dev/sdk/v1/default?platformId=WIN * Added api.epicgames.dev:443:44.198.255.91 to DNS cache * Hostname api.epicgames.dev was found in DNS cache * Trying 44.198.255.91:443... * Connected to api.epicgames.dev (44.198.255.91) port 443 * ALPN: curl offers h2,http/1.1 * TLSv1.3 (OUT), TLS handshake, Client hello (1): * TLSv1.3 (IN), TLS handshake, Server hello (2): * TLSv1.2 (IN), TLS handshake, Certificate (11): * TLSv1.2 (IN), TLS handshake, Server key exchange (12): * TLSv1.2 (IN), TLS handshake, Server finished (14): * TLSv1.2 (OUT), TLS handshake, Client key exchange (16): * TLSv1.2 (OUT), TLS change cipher, Change cipher spec (1): * TLSv1.2 (OUT), TLS handshake, Finished (20): * TLSv1.2 (IN), TLS handshake, Finished (20): * SSL connection using TLSv1.2 / ECDHE-RSA-AES128-GCM-SHA256 / prime256v1 / rsaEncryption * ALPN: server accepted h2 * Server certificate: * subject: C=US; ST=California; L=Irvine; O=CoreLogic, Inc.; CN=*.okcmar.mlsmatrix.com * start date: Mar 18 00:00:00 2024 GMT * expire date: Feb 22 23:59:59 2025 GMT * subjectAltName does not match host name api.epicgames.dev * SSL: no alternative certificate subject name matches target host name 'api.epicgames.dev' * Closing connection * TLSv1.2 (OUT), TLS alert, close notify (256): curl: (60) SSL: no alternative certificate subject name matches target host name 'api.epicgames.dev' More details here: https://curl.se/docs/sslcerts.html curl failed to verify the legitimacy of the server and therefore could not establish a secure connection to it.
